What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b):   a) Exterior of Building - Roof Front: Employees without any means of fall protection were exposed to fall hazards of approximately 10 feet while engaged in roofing activities , on or about 5/24/18.

29 CFR 1926.1053(b)(4): Ladder(s) were used for purposes other than the purpose for which they were designed      a) Exterior of Building - Back: Employees were exposed to an approximately 10 feet fall hazard while utilizing a step ladder in the closed position, on or about 5/24/18
